A musty smell in the basement or crawl space is usually moisture you can't see yet, not just "old house smell."
Hairline cracks can widen over a Port Jefferson Station winter's freeze-thaw cycle and become active leak points by spring.
That white chalky film on basement walls is efflorescence — mineral deposits left behind as water evaporates through concrete.
A pump under constant strain tends to fail at the worst possible time — usually during the next big Port Jefferson Station storm.
If a foundation wall looks like it's leaning or bulging inward, that's beyond a simple seal and needs a full assessment.
Peeling paint low on a basement wall or warped baseboards upstairs often trace back to moisture migrating up from below.
